According to reports of Baaghi TV, A follow-up notice has been issued for June 10 in the defamation case against Imran Khan.

According to sources, Additional District Judge Lahore Muhammad Sohail Anjum has issued a follow-up notice to Prime Minister Imran Khan for June 10 at the request of Shahbaz Sharif.

Shahbaz Sharif had taken a stand in the petition that Dr. Babar Awan could not pursue the case after becoming an advisor. A lawyer who does not do so is found guilty of misconduct. The name of the lawyer who commits professional misconduct is removed from the list of lawyers. Imran Khan’s deputy lawyer should be fined for giving false testimony in court.

Shahbaz Sharif further said in the petition that the trial has been going on for 3 years but Imran Khan did not submit a written reply. In 60 hearings, Imran Khan filed adjournment petitions 33 times.

According to the petition, the court order sheet is a clear indication of Imran Khan’s carelessness and reckless behavior.

In June, it was again requested that Imran Khan’s lawyer Babar Awan could not come to Lahore from Islamabad due to corona. This statement is a case of lying and perjury. Imran Khan should be issued a follow-up notice in his personal capacity.

It is to be noted that Shahbaz Sharif had filed an application for early hearing of the compensation case against Imran Khan for alleging Rs 10 billion.
